Why are historical maps of Palmetto important for research and professional purposes?
Historical maps of Palmetto offer a unique perspective on an area's past, making them invaluable for environmental consultants, surveyors, legal professionals, geneologists, historians, and hobbyists alike. They are used in environmental site assessments, lot line research, and land dispute resolution.
